    Quote Originally Posted by electricblue View Post
    Is there a fix for this yet? I'm having the same issue.
    Yes it is fixed in the latest release available from our downloads page here:
    http://www.efilive.com/index.php?opt...=48&Itemid=133

    The Auto-update has been switched off so you'll need to download both V7.5 and V8 and install both V7.5 and V8 manually (i.e. by double clicking on the downloaded files).
    Make sure you use the V8 software EFILive_HAPI to update the firmware in your FlashScan.
